In a single-factor analysis of variance, MST is the mean square for treatments and MSE is the mean square for error. The null hypothesis of equal population means is rejected if:
 a. MST is much larger than MSE. c. MST is equal to MSE.
  b. MST is much smaller than MSE. d. None of these choices.
